We wandered onto a back road, just to see where it went. Decided to follow an arroyo, (a steep sided gully formed by the fast flowing water in a desert). Collected some rocks “just because”, and kept exploring down the road. It kept going on for quite a while, that’s why there are so many edits. Sofia decided that we should head back because she was getting hungry. She tolerated a 2 hour side road, I can’t fault her for that. Another great day in Wickenburg Arizona.
